Start your romantic getaway by basking in the sun-kissed beaches of Diu. Begin your morning with a visit to Nagoa Beach, a serene and picturesque stretch of coastline. Enjoy a leisurely walk along the shore, hand in hand, as you take in the breathtaking views of the Arabian Sea. In the afternoon, indulge in water sports activities such as jet skiing and parasailing at Ghoghla Beach. As the evening approaches, head to the serene Sunset Point and witness the magical hues painting the sky as the sun sets. This intimate moment will create memories to cherish forever.
Immerse yourself in the rich history and culture of Diu on your second day. Start your morning by exploring the magnificent Diu Fort, a UNESCO World Heritage Site. Admire the Portuguese architecture and stroll along the historic walls of this fortress. In the afternoon, visit St. Paul's Church, known for its exquisite baroque-style architecture. Afterward, unwind at the tranquil Gangeshwar Mahadev Temple, surrounded by five Shiva lingams. As the evening sets in, take a romantic walk along the Diu Promenade, enjoying the cool sea breeze and the mesmerizing view of the illuminated fort.
Spend your final day in Diu exploring the natural beauty that the island has to offer. Start your morning with a visit to the tranquil Jallandhar Beach, known for its crystal-clear waters and peaceful surroundings. Enjoy a romantic picnic on the beach and take a dip in the inviting sea. In the afternoon, venture to the breathtaking Naida Caves, a network of intricately carved caves surrounded by lush greenery. Conclude your trip with a visit to the serene Chakratirth Beach, where you can relax and soak in the beauty of nature.
For a truly unique experience, explore the hidden gem of Diu - Ghoghla Village. This charming village offers a glimpse into the local way of life, with traditional houses, narrow lanes, and friendly locals. Take a leisurely stroll through the village, interact with the residents, and savor the authentic Gujarati cuisine at one of the local eateries. Another local favorite is the Diu Museum, which houses a collection of artifacts showcasing the island's history. Don't forget to try the famous local drink, coconut water, during your visit to Diu!
